|
[Search] Поиск   [Recent Topics] Последние темы   [Hottest Topics] Горячие темы   [Members]  Список участников   [Groups] На главную страницу 
[Register] Регистрация / 
[Login] Вход 
Опыты с 2.0RC через SOAPGUI - успехи и проблемы.  XML
Индекс форума » Компонент МЕРКУРИЙ
Автор Сообщение
mevgenym


Зарегистрирован: 19/05/2017 14:03:42
Сообщений: 312
Оффлайн

Владимир Игнатов wrote:
Сервис получения сведений из базовых справочников: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/DictionaryService_v2.0.wsdl
Сервис получения сведений из реестра хоз.субъектов и предприятий: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/EnterpriseService_v2.0.wsdl
Сервис получения адресно-справочной информации: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/IkarService_v2.0.wsdl
Сервис получения сведений из справочников продукции и номенклатуры: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/ProductService_v2.0.wsdl
Сервис получения сведений из реестра правил регионализации: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/RegionalizationService_v2.0.wsdl


Эти не рабочие. Откуда такая инфа? Капец почему все прячут так?
https://github.com/mevgenym/1c_vetis.api_v1.1
https://github.com/mevgenym/1c_vetis.api
Владимир Игнатов


Зарегистрирован: 02/08/2017 09:19:30
Сообщений: 581
Оффлайн

mevgenym wrote:
Владимир Игнатов wrote:
Сервис получения сведений из базовых справочников: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/DictionaryService_v2.0.wsdl
Сервис получения сведений из реестра хоз.субъектов и предприятий: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/EnterpriseService_v2.0.wsdl
Сервис получения адресно-справочной информации: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/IkarService_v2.0.wsdl
Сервис получения сведений из справочников продукции и номенклатуры: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/ProductService_v2.0.wsdl
Сервис получения сведений из реестра правил регионализации: http://api.vetrf.ru/schema/platform/services/2.0-RC-last/RegionalizationService_v2.0.wsdl


Эти не рабочие. Откуда такая инфа? Капец почему все прячут так?

Там к концу имени тоже надо добавить _pilot, как у рабочих.
Aiki

[Avatar]

Зарегистрирован: 01/09/2017 22:13:04
Сообщений: 39
Оффлайн

Итак, производство, на чем пока можно закончить спамить сообщениями с CODE..

Простое производство
[WWW]
Aiki

[Avatar]

Зарегистрирован: 01/09/2017 22:13:04
Сообщений: 39
Оффлайн

незавершенное производство
1 часть - выход ГП

2 часть - потребление и завершение
[WWW]
Aiki

[Avatar]

Зарегистрирован: 01/09/2017 22:13:04
Сообщений: 39
Оффлайн

Комментарии по производству.
1. Спасибо разработчикам, что убрали упаковку, как требование. Идея хорошая, но упаковку действительно тяжело подтянуть к процессам. Проще при отгрузке указать.
2. Странно, что для выхода продукции упаковка не наследуется от номенклатуры ? (мне же не показалось?)
3. на WEB все транзакции имеют вид незавершенного производства. (косяк)
Вопросы:
1. Фантастический тэг operationId - мне показалось, что его не видно в ответах на запрос getVetDocumentListRequest? (а как потом поймать, если что?), его не видно и на WEB..
2. Если кто случайно сделает последнее списание/выход без тэга финализации, потом прозводство не завершить? (кроме хитро досписать 0,001 кг, к примеру?)
3. Кто читал примеры в документации, в чем разница примеров 3 и 4?
4. Я верно понимаю, что сделать второй выход другой номенклатуры в незавершенном пр-ве нельзя, только выход той-же?
a. + SKU1
b. - RAW +SKU1; +SKU2

Это сообщение было редактировано 1 раз. Последнее обновление произошло в 21/09/2017 14:32:33

[WWW]
ПользовательRex


Зарегистрирован: 06/06/2017 07:48:13
Сообщений: 38
Оффлайн

Добрый день!
Есть успехи с операциями updateVeterinaryEventsRequest, GetResearchMethodList?
Как получить список Показателей безопасности?
Aiki

[Avatar]

Зарегистрирован: 01/09/2017 22:13:04
Сообщений: 39
Оффлайн

ПользовательRex wrote:Добрый день!
Есть успехи с операциями updateVeterinaryEventsRequest, GetResearchMethodList?
Как получить список Показателей безопасности?


По-моему GetResearchMethodList - не рабочий. Надо написать разработчикам.
по поводу updateVeterinaryEventsRequest - пока не уверен, что есть его применения для ХС, которое не работает с первичным сырьем... Или не прав?
[WWW]
ПользовательRex


Зарегистрирован: 06/06/2017 07:48:13
Сообщений: 38
Оффлайн

Производство мясных полуфабрикатов например. Лаб исследования нужно как-то "прикрутить".
Vesta_IT


Зарегистрирован: 16/09/2017 15:07:38
Сообщений: 61
Оффлайн

что-то туплю.. подскажите - кидаю на https://api2.vetrf.ru:8002/platform/services/2.0/ApplicationManagementService

запрос вида:


возвращает ошибку

<apl:error code="APLM0007" xmlns:apl="http://api.vetrf.ru/schema/cdm/application">Wrong application data format. Format validation failed due to XML Schema rules: Элемент 'initiator' не предусмотрен.</apl:error>

если убрать инициатора, то начинает ругаться налист опшионс и т.д. что-то я явно делаю не так.

Это сообщение было редактировано 1 раз. Последнее обновление произошло в 21/09/2017 17:50:51

Владимир Игнатов


Зарегистрирован: 02/08/2017 09:19:30
Сообщений: 581
Оффлайн

Vesta_IT wrote:что-то туплю.. подскажите - кидаю на https://api2.vetrf.ru:8002/platform/services/2.0/ApplicationManagementService

если убрать инициатора, то начинает ругаться налист опшионс и т.д. что-то я явно делаю не так.


Полагаю, нужен localTransactionId.
Vesta_IT


Зарегистрирован: 16/09/2017 15:07:38
Сообщений: 61
Оффлайн

ага. спасибо!
кfк раз втулил localid - (а что сн им дальше-то делать? к нему есть требования, он должен быть все время уникальным?)
но оказалось что не тот логин указал в инициаторе - указал логин к Ветис-АПИ а нужен логин пользователя (которы из ветис.паспорт).
сложно все )
ПользовательRex


Зарегистрирован: 06/06/2017 07:48:13
Сообщений: 38
Оффлайн

Что не так при запросе updateVeterinaryEventsRequest? Почему такие ошибки?
Результат и наименование указаны же <vd:conclusion> и <vd:indicator> - <dt:name>.

<apl:error code="MERC78512" xmlns:apl="http://api.vetrf.ru/schema/cdm/application">Результат исследований обязателен для заполнения.</apl:error>
<apl:error code="MERC78505" xmlns:apl="http://api.vetrf.ru/schema/cdm/application">Наименование показателя обязательно для заполнения.</apl:error>

Это сообщение было редактировано 1 раз. Последнее обновление произошло в 22/09/2017 06:42:52

nsnt


Зарегистрирован: 31/05/2017 09:06:10
Сообщений: 242
Оффлайн

Подскажите, пожалуйста, кто может.
На тестовом сервере в веб-интерфейсе при гашении ВСД появился обязательный реквизит "Номер производственной партии". Без него не дает погасить, с ним создает акт несоответствия по причине разных номеров производственной партии, о чем в справке нигде никаких упоминаний нет.
В итоге после этого я по api 1.4 вижу этот номер партии в записи складского журнала в списке маркировок, у маркировки указан класс BN.
Когда после этого я делаю в веб-интерфейсе транспортную операцию по этой записи складского журнала, то в исходящем ВСД данных о маркировке нет.
Вопрос, как это выглядит в api 2.0? Там видно эти данные в ВСД?
Agnostik


Зарегистрирован: 23/04/2017 11:02:14
Сообщений: 478
Оффлайн

у всех норм с BB-кодами сообщений? я не могу ничего с ними отправить, уж думал, забанили...

Это сообщение было редактировано 1 раз. Последнее обновление произошло в 29/09/2017 17:08:08

Aiki

[Avatar]

Зарегистрирован: 01/09/2017 22:13:04
Сообщений: 39
Оффлайн

nsnt wrote:Подскажите, пожалуйста, кто может.
На тестовом сервере в веб-интерфейсе при гашении ВСД появился обязательный реквизит "Номер производственной партии". Без него не дает погасить, с ним создает акт несоответствия по причине разных номеров производственной партии, о чем в справке нигде никаких упоминаний нет.
В итоге после этого я по api 1.4 вижу этот номер партии в записи складского журнала в списке маркировок, у маркировки указан класс BN.
Когда после этого я делаю в веб-интерфейсе транспортную операцию по этой записи складского журнала, то в исходящем ВСД данных о маркировке нет.
Вопрос, как это выглядит в api 2.0? Там видно эти данные в ВСД?


Добрый в API 2.0 номер партии при гашении обязателен ( <v21:batchID>VAL723456789</v21:batchID>
Но это не тоже, что в маркировке BN. Я при тестах вообще для гашения не указывал маркировку.
[WWW]
 
Индекс форума » Компонент МЕРКУРИЙ
Перейти:   

Powered by JForum 2.1.8 © JForum Team